Played a QB against the AI last week set to heavy woods. Gave myself infantry and the AI Armour. By some fluke, the woods left only a keyhole 2 tiles wide from the armour to get through. The bottleneck was 100m beyond my setup zone so I moved 2 TH teams with RPG grenades and a flamethrower to the edges of the neck, thinking I might get a couple of tanks before his infantry got me. An antire platoon (5) of Mk IVs and two heavy ACs obligingly blundered through the gap unescorted and were wiped out to the last. The flamthrower got one AC and two tanks. This cut the AI's morale down so badly that his infantry meandered around in the woods without contacting the rest of my defence, so the rest of my forces never got a whiff.

I once played a homemade scenario (if that's what "QB" means??) where I ended up with a Wehrmacht flamethrower team hidden in a foxhole, at the edge of some tall pines with a 30-meter arc laid down on a narrow corridor between the pines and a roadblock. There were no other friendly units in the vicinity or even with a LOS to the spot - it was more of a last-ditch defense than anything. I was tending to another part of the battlefield at one point during the game, and returned to the FT team, finding to my surprise that the team was unhidden, with a SU-122 blazing merrily in the corridor, flank exposed to the FT team. So yes, FT's can work if you can site them to make efficient use of their limited range.
